description Genetic diversity levels in 4 native populations of Finnish spruce and Scots pine each and 2 fields of conifer seed orchard growing in Karelia have been investigated using microsatellite loci. As a result high levels of basic genetic diversity parameters have been revealed for native populations of both species. It was found that expected heterozygosity figers calculated for the populations investigated were higher than the observed ones. This case thereby indicates a deficit of heterozygotes in the Karelian pine and spruce populations. Genetic diversity figures found for spruce seed orchard were much lower than for native populations of Picea x fennica. This fact, in our opinion, reflects the unsufficent representation of genetic pool both within the seed orchard field investigated and in spruce plus trees' breeding population on the whole. Scots pine seed orchard has been characterised by a high level of genetic diversity matched to native populations one.
